Creamiest Condensed Milk Baked Rice Pudding Recipe
This Creamiest Condensed Milk Baked Rice Pudding is an easy homemade dessert featuring tender short-grain rice cooked in whole milk and enriched with sweetened condensed milk, eggs, and warm spices. Baked to a golden perfection, this comforting pudding delivers a creamy texture and delightful cinnamon aroma, perfect for a cozy treat.

Main Ingredients
- 1 cup (200g) short-grain rice
- 1 can (14 oz / 395g) sweetened condensed milk
- 2 cups (480ml) whole milk
- 3 large eggs, room temperature
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- Pinch of salt
- 2 tablespoons butter (for greasing and dotting on top)
- Preheat and prepare dish: Preheat your oven to 325°F (160°C). Butter a 9×9-inch baking dish thoroughly, including the sides, to prevent sticking and add richness.
- Rinse the rice: Rinse 1 cup (200g) of short-grain rice under cold water until the water runs clear to remove excess starch, ensuring a creamy yet distinct texture.
- Cook the rice: In a medium saucepan, combine the rinsed rice, 2 cups (480ml) whole milk, and a pinch of salt. Bring to a gentle simmer over medium-low heat, stirring occasionally to prevent sticking. Cook until the rice is tender but still slightly firm, about 18-20 minutes.
- Mix the custard base: While the rice is cooking, whisk together 3 large room temperature eggs, 1 can (395g) sweetened condensed milk, 1 teaspoon vanilla extract, and 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on in a large bowl until smooth and slightly frothy.
- Combine rice and custard: Carefully stir the warm cooked rice into the egg and condensed milk mixture gently to avoid scrambling the eggs, ensuring an even, creamy mixture.
- Assemble the pudding: Pour the pudding mixture into the prepared baking dish. Dot the top with about 1 tablespoon of butter to add richness and develop a golden crust during baking.
- Bake: Bake in the preheated oven for 50 to 60 minutes until the top turns golden and slightly puffed. The edges should be set, and the center should still jiggle slightly when gently shaken, indicating a creamy texture.
- Cool and serve: Let the pudding cool for at least 15 minutes before serving. Serve warm or at room temperature. Optionally, sprinkle with additional cinnamon or toasted nuts for extra flavor and texture.
Notes
- Use short-grain rice for the creamiest texture; long-grain rice will not achieve the same results.
- Allow the eggs to come to room temperature to ensure even mixing and prevent curdling.
- The pudding will set further as it cools; do not overbake to avoid dryness.
- Optionally garnish with toasted nuts or a sprinkle of cinnamon before serving for added flavor.
- Leftovers can be refrigerated for up to 3 days and reheated gently.
